[ios] 연락처 정보 공유 기능

iOS 애플리케이션에서 연락처 정보를 다른 사용자와 공유하는 기능은 매우 유용하고 중요합니다. iOS의 연락처 공유 기능을 사용하여 사용자가 다른 사람들과 쉽게 연락처 정보를 공유할 수 있도록 지원할 수 있습니다.

연락처 정보 공유 기능 구현

연락처 공유 기능은 인트로앱과 UIActivitiyViewController를 사용하여 구현할 수 있습니다. 사용자가 연락처 정보를 공유할 때 표시되는 액티비티 뷰 컨트롤러에 연락처 정보를 제공하여 사용자가 다양한 방법으로 공유할 수 있도록 합니다.

let contactName = "John Doe"
let phoneNumber = "1234567890"

let contactItem = "\(contactName)\n\(phoneNumber)"
let activityViewController = UIActivityViewController(activityItems: [contactItem], applicationActivities: nil)
present(activityViewController, animated: true, completion: nil)

위의 예시 코드에서는 연락처 정보를 문자열 형식으로 준비하고, UIActivityViewController를 사용하여 연락처 정보를 다양한 방법으로 공유할 수 있도록 합니다.

결론

iOS에서 연락처 정보를 공유하는 기능은 사용자들이 손쉽게 연락처 정보를 공유할 수 있도록 도와주는 중요한 기능입니다. UIActivityViewController를 사용하여 간단히 이 기능을 구현할 수 있으며, 사용자 경험을 향상시킬 수 있습니다.

참고 문헌: